Output f8e41bbcd4e8457fb7356fe7b1f21fac243fc06fa1707498b68d9249f8a5323d:0

value
995737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d420f8c84ff1b7b2a83c79d431d704fb2ae3aa9 OP_EQUAL
address
34Mif62BHjRWgdYmZWArfP9Ko7ArfbzEpy
transaction
f8e41bbcd4e8457fb7356fe7b1f21fac243fc06fa1707498b68d9249f8a5323d
confirmations
255922
spent
true